This handbook provides an in-depth account of the origins, style, and performance history of Richard Wagner's popular operatic masterpiece Der Fliegende Holländer (The Flying Dutchman). Designed for scholars, performers and the opera-going public alike, the book represents the most detailed discussion of the opera currently available in English.
